Physical therapy plays an important role in the treatment and recovery process of most orthopedic conditions. Whether you are recovering from a surgical procedure, overcoming an orthopedic injury or managing a chronic disorder, physical therapy can help you:
- Restore movement and mobility.
- Maintain or improve range of motion.
- Improve strength.
- Restore or improve function.
- Relieve bone and joint stress.
- Promote faster recovery.
- Regain independence.
- Increase endurance.
Effective Outpatient Treatments
At Salt Lake Regional, our physical therapy team has extensive experience working with patients recovering from a wide variety of orthopedic injuries and surgeries. Collaborating closely with your orthopedic physician or surgeon, we use the latest treatment techniques to reduce pain, facilitate a smooth recovery and enable you to get back on track as quickly as possible. Treatment programs may include:
- Strengthening exercises.
- Stretching exercises.
- Soft tissue mobilization.
- Joint mobilization.
- Traction.
- McKenzie-based directional movements.
- Pain modulating modalities (i.e. ice/heat applications, electrical stimulation, ultrasound, etc.).
We provide physical therapy services for a wide variety of orthopedic issues, including:
Shoulders:
- Shoulder impingements.
- Shoulder instabilities.
- Surgical repairs and replacements.
Elbows, Wrists and Hands:
- Dislocations.
- Fractures.
- Carpal tunnel syndrome (CTS).
- De Quervian’s tenosynovitis (wrist inflammation).
- Lateral epicondylitis (tennis elbow).
- Medial epicondylitis (golfer’s elbow).
Hips:
- Bursitis (inflammation).
- Surgical repairs and replacements.
Knees:
- Patellofemral pain (runner’s knee).
- Patellar tendonopathy (jumper’s knee).
- Ligament and meniscal injuries.
- Total and partial knee arthroplasty.
- Other surgical repairs and replacements.
Lower Leg, Foot and Ankle:
- Sprains.
- Strains.
- Stress fractures.
- Compartment syndromes and shin splints.
- Surgical repairs and replacements.
- Plantar fasciitis (foot inflammation).
Spine:
- Back pain and injuries.
- Neck pain and injuries.
- Surgical repairs.
